Re: Anyone planted beets into hariy vetch and rye no-till?
We have done tomatoes, eggplant, peppers, and squash very successfully using the Steve Groff/Ron Morse system of no-till, but with absolutely no herbicides ever. We are wondering about beets, which we've ususally planted early spring, but of course we couldn't plant til the end of May or early June in order to wait for the rye and vetch to be far enough along to roll down.
I would really appreciate any feedback regarding experience in this area!
